如何使用jQuery去掉var数据为空
介绍
在开发中,我们经常会遇到需要去掉一个变量的空值的情况。使用jQuery可以很方便地实现这个功能。本文将介绍如何使用jQuery去掉var数据为空的方法,并给出具体的代码示例。
整体流程
下面是实现这个功能的整体流程,我们将使用一个表格展示每个步骤。
步骤 | 动作 |
---|---|
步骤1 | 获取变量的值 |
步骤2 | 判断变量是否为空 |
步骤3 | 如果变量为空,则删除该变量 |
步骤4 | 如果变量不为空,则保留该变量 |
接下来,我们将详细介绍每个步骤需要做的事情,并给出相应的代码示例。
步骤1:获取变量的值
首先,我们需要获取变量的值。这可以通过jQuery的选择器来实现。假设我们的变量是一个input元素的值,我们可以使用以下代码来获取值:
var value = $("input").val();
在这个例子中,我们使用了jQuery的选择器$("input")
来选取所有的input元素,并使用.val()
方法获取其值,并将其赋值给变量value
。
步骤2:判断变量是否为空
接下来,我们需要判断变量是否为空。我们可以使用JavaScript的条件语句来实现这个判断。以下是一个示例代码:
if (value === "") {
// 变量为空的处理代码
} else {
// 变量不为空的处理代码
}
在这个例子中,我们使用了JavaScript的条件语句if...else
来判断变量value
是否为空。如果变量为空,则执行注释为“变量为空的处理代码”的代码块;如果变量不为空,则执行注释为“变量不为空的处理代码”的代码块。
步骤3:如果变量为空,则删除该变量
如果变量为空,我们需要将其删除。使用jQuery可以很方便地实现这一步骤。以下是一个示例代码:
if (value === "") {
$("input").remove();
}
在这个例子中,我们使用了jQuery的.remove()
方法来删除选中的元素。在这里,我们选择了所有的input元素,并使用$("input")
来选中它们,并使用.remove()
方法将其删除。
步骤4:如果变量不为空,则保留该变量
如果变量不为空,我们需要将其保留。使用jQuery可以很方便地实现这一步骤。以下是一个示例代码:
if (value !== "") {
// 变量不为空的处理代码
}
在这个例子中,我们使用了JavaScript的条件语句if
来判断变量value
是否不为空。如果变量不为空,则执行注释为“变量不为空的处理代码”的代码块。
状态图
下面是一个使用mermaid语法标识的状态图,表示我们的整体流程:
stateDiagram
[*] --> 步骤1
步骤1 --> 步骤2
步骤2 --> 步骤3
步骤2 --> 步骤4
步骤3 --> [*]
步骤4 --> [*]
总结
本文介绍了如何使用jQuery去掉var数据为空的方法。我们通过一个表格展示了整体流程,并给出了每个步骤需要做的事情和相应的代码示例。希望本文能帮助刚入行的小白理解并掌握这个技巧。通过学习和实践,你将能够更好地使用jQuery来处理变量为空的情况。